Abstract

A pivotable cassette housing for a magnetic recording and reproducing apparatus, comprising a pivotable bracket formed of a single metal plate, to have an integral construction, and a cassette holder mounted in the bracket and adapted to receive a tape cassette therein. The pivotable bracket has a pair of side walls and a pair of connecting portions integrally formed with the side walls and adapted to connect the side walls with each other, one of the connecting members having a cross section with a stepped shape and the other having a cross section with a shape having opposite protruded ends. Each of the side walls has a guide pin extending inwardly from an inner surface of the side wall and the cassette holder has a guide slot for receiving the guide pin, to mount the cassette holder in the bracket. The bracket is formed by blanking a single metal plate into a construction having a pair of side wall portions, a pair of connecting portions for connecting the side walls with each other, bending the side wall portions of the construction into a shape corresponding the side walls of the bracket, and forming a plurality of recesses at the resultant bent edges of the side wall portions…
